
Dharani Gudikota enhanced the pucardotorg/dristi-solutions and related repositories by delivering cohesive UI upgrades, robust dashboard integrations, and automation tools that improved both user experience and developer efficiency. She upgraded the Dristi UI CSS library to ensure consistent styling, integrated Metabase dashboards for dynamic analytics, and re-enabled critical data fields in the dristi_cases persistence layer. Her work included developing a Bash script to automate cherry-picking across branches, streamlining release workflows. Using JavaScript, React, and SQL, Dharani focused on risk mitigation, configuration stability, and clear documentation, demonstrating a thoughtful approach to cross-repo collaboration and maintainable, production-ready code.

October 2025 highlights: Delivered cross-repo UI consistency, data integrity improvements, and release automation that boost product quality and developer velocity. Key actions included synchronizing the Dristi UI CSS across pucardotorg/dristi-solutions to ensure styling consistency and access to latest fixes, restoring essential data capture by re-enabling the Witness Details field in the dristi_cases persistence layer, and accelerating releases with an automation script to cherry-pick commits across branches and open PRs. Additional value was realized through improved dashboard visibility and public access: updating the Metabase hearing progress dashboard URL and enabling a public dashboard embed route on Oncourts_Landing_page. Finally, task naming clarity and broader UI/case management and payment improvements reduced ambiguity and enhanced user experience.
October 2025 highlights: Delivered cross-repo UI consistency, data integrity improvements, and release automation that boost product quality and developer velocity. Key actions included synchronizing the Dristi UI CSS across pucardotorg/dristi-solutions to ensure styling consistency and access to latest fixes, restoring essential data capture by re-enabling the Witness Details field in the dristi_cases persistence layer, and accelerating releases with an automation script to cherry-pick commits across branches and open PRs. Additional value was realized through improved dashboard visibility and public access: updating the Metabase hearing progress dashboard URL and enabling a public dashboard embed route on Oncourts_Landing_page. Finally, task naming clarity and broader UI/case management and payment improvements reduced ambiguity and enhanced user experience.
September 2025 (2025-09) monthly summary for pucardotorg/dristi-solutions focusing on delivering business value through UI consistency, analytics/dashboard improvements, and robust logout flow. Key features were deployed to enhance user experience and decision support, while a critical logout bug fix improved session reliability and observability.
September 2025 (2025-09) monthly summary for pucardotorg/dristi-solutions focusing on delivering business value through UI consistency, analytics/dashboard improvements, and robust logout flow. Key features were deployed to enhance user experience and decision support, while a critical logout bug fix improved session reliability and observability.
Monthly Performance Summary - 2025-08 Overview: Focused on stabilizing UI consistency and configuration baselines across two key repositories, delivering value through a cohesive front-end styling upgrade and controlled configuration changes to reduce risk and simplify future deployments. Key outcomes: - Improved frontend consistency by upgrading the Dristi UI CSS library across the application, aligning styles and reducing visual drift. This was implemented across two index.html entry points with commits contributing to a unified look and easier future maintenance. - Stabilized config baseline by reverting two recent changes in Kerala configs to eliminate instability introduced by the fixes for revoke litigant variable and Poa application new config, ensuring safer deployments until a more robust long-term solution is formulated. - Strengthened cross-repo collaboration and traceability by clearly mapping changes to features/bugs and tying commits to specific outcomes, enabling clearer impact assessment and faster rollback if needed. - Demonstrated robust engineering skills in CSS asset management, change management, and risk mitigation, reinforcing reliability and user experience in production. Overall impact and accomplishments: - Business value: Consistent UI across the app reduces training and support costs and improves user satisfaction; config rollback reduces risk of feature regressions in production. - Technical excellence: Efficiently managed multi-repo changes with clear commit messaging, ensuring traceability and faster future iterations. Technologies/skills demonstrated: - Front-end CSS library management, HTML asset coordination, Git-based change control, release risk mitigation, cross-repo collaboration, and documentation of changes for audit and onboarding purposes.
Monthly Performance Summary - 2025-08 Overview: Focused on stabilizing UI consistency and configuration baselines across two key repositories, delivering value through a cohesive front-end styling upgrade and controlled configuration changes to reduce risk and simplify future deployments. Key outcomes: - Improved frontend consistency by upgrading the Dristi UI CSS library across the application, aligning styles and reducing visual drift. This was implemented across two index.html entry points with commits contributing to a unified look and easier future maintenance. - Stabilized config baseline by reverting two recent changes in Kerala configs to eliminate instability introduced by the fixes for revoke litigant variable and Poa application new config, ensuring safer deployments until a more robust long-term solution is formulated. - Strengthened cross-repo collaboration and traceability by clearly mapping changes to features/bugs and tying commits to specific outcomes, enabling clearer impact assessment and faster rollback if needed. - Demonstrated robust engineering skills in CSS asset management, change management, and risk mitigation, reinforcing reliability and user experience in production. Overall impact and accomplishments: - Business value: Consistent UI across the app reduces training and support costs and improves user satisfaction; config rollback reduces risk of feature regressions in production. - Technical excellence: Efficiently managed multi-repo changes with clear commit messaging, ensuring traceability and faster future iterations. Technologies/skills demonstrated: - Front-end CSS library management, HTML asset coordination, Git-based change control, release risk mitigation, cross-repo collaboration, and documentation of changes for audit and onboarding purposes.
Overview of all repositories you've contributed to across your timeline